Expected Value of a CSGOWin Case
Players who want to evaluate Cases more analytically can calculate approximate expected value.
Suppose a fictional 10 Coin Case contains:
| Drop | Value | Probability |
|---|---|---|
| Skin A | 2 | 50% |
| Skin B | 7 | 30% |
| Skin C | 20 | 15% |
| Skin D | 70 | 5% |
Expected value:
(2 × 0.50) + (7 × 0.30) + (20 × 0.15) + (70 × 0.05)
=
1 + 2.1 + 3 + 3.5
=
9.6 Coins
If the case costs 10 Coins:
Expected return = 96%
Approximate house edge:
4%
This doesn’t mean you’ll receive exactly 9.6 Coins from every 10 Coin Case.
It means that over a sufficiently large theoretical sample, the average outcome approaches that value if the published probabilities and valuations remain constant.

How Provably Fair Usually Works
A typical Provably Fair system combines values such as:
Server Seed
Generated by the gambling platform.
Client Seed
A value associated with or potentially controlled by the player.
Nonce
A counter that changes as additional bets are made.
The system then applies a cryptographic function to these inputs.
Conceptually:
Server Seed + Client Seed + Nonce → Hash Algorithm → Random Result
The exact implementation varies between games and platforms.
For this reason, users should use CSGOWin’s live fairness/verifier interface for the exact current calculation rather than assuming every CSGOWin game uses an identical formula.
Why the Server Seed Is Hashed
One of the key ideas behind Provably Fair gambling is commitment.
Before a result is generated, the platform can provide a cryptographic hash representing the secret server seed.
For example:
Hidden Server Seed
↓
SHA-256
↓
Public Hash
The player can’t derive the original server seed from the hash.
After the seed is eventually revealed, however, it becomes possible to check whether:
SHA-256(revealed seed) = original published hash
If it does, that provides evidence that the server seed wasn’t simply replaced after the outcome was known.
Provably Fair Does Not Mean Profitable
This distinction is extremely important.
Provably Fair ≠ Positive Expected Value
A game can be completely random and verifiable while still containing a house edge.
Suppose a game provides:
RTP: 95%
That implies an approximate theoretical house edge of:
100% − 95% = 5%
Provably Fair can help demonstrate that the random result was generated according to the disclosed mechanism.
It doesn’t make the 5% mathematical disadvantage disappear.

Don’t Confuse Cash-Out Control With Player Advantage
Mines creates an interesting psychological effect.
Because you decide when to stop, it can feel more skill-based than Cases.
But your decision to cash out doesn’t remove the underlying mathematics.
Imagine you’ve already uncovered:
5 safe tiles
and your multiplier has increased significantly.
Continuing isn’t “free” simply because you’re already in profit.
The next click creates another risk decision.
Previous safe selections don’t guarantee that the next tile will also be safe.

Fast Games Can Increase Gambling Volume
Suppose someone opens one Battle every five minutes.
During one hour:
approximately 12 gambling events.
Now imagine a Roulette round occurring every 30 seconds.
During the same hour:
approximately 120 gambling events.
Even with much smaller individual wagers, total gambling volume can increase rapidly.
That’s why session limits can be particularly important with:
Roulette
Mines
and:
Plinko.

Why P2P Withdrawals Matter
Traditional bot inventories have a fundamental limitation:
The site can only offer items currently sitting in its bots.
If hundreds of users want:
AK-47 Redline
but the bots have none available, users need to wait or select another skin.
A P2P system can potentially increase market liquidity by connecting more inventory.
That can mean:
more skins
more price points
greater inventory diversity
and potentially:
better availability.

Crypto Deposit Safety
Before sending cryptocurrency to any casino:
Check the coin.
BTC is not ETH.
Check the network.
USDT can exist across multiple blockchain networks.
Check the address.
One incorrect character can be enough to send funds elsewhere.
Check minimum deposits.
Amounts below a processor’s minimum may not be credited normally.
Check network fees.
The amount received can differ from the amount sent.
Most importantly:
Blockchain transactions are generally irreversible.
A casino support agent cannot simply reverse an incorrectly addressed blockchain transaction.

Fake Steam Login Windows
This is particularly dangerous.
A phishing site can display what appears to be a Steam login popup.
But instead of opening an authentic Steam page, it can render a fake login form directly inside the malicious website.
Always verify the domain before entering:
- Steam username
- password
- Steam Guard code.
Never trust the appearance of a login window alone.

Don’t Gamble More for CSGOWin Rakeback
Suppose you’re $20 away from the next reward.
It can be tempting to think:
“I’ll wager another $200 and unlock it.”
But the relevant calculation isn’t just the reward.
It’s:
Expected Reward − Expected Gambling Loss
If the extra gambling exposure costs more mathematically than the reward is worth, chasing the bonus makes no financial sense.
Treat rewards as a benefit from activity you were already going to undertake, not as a reason to increase wagering.
Don’t Chase CSGOWin Case Battle Losses
Case Battles can create particularly strong loss-chasing pressure.
Imagine:
Battle 1 → −$20
Battle 2 → −$50
Battle 3 → −$100
You may then think:
“I’ll enter a $200 Battle and recover everything.”
But Battle 4 has no knowledge of Battles 1–3.
A larger stake doesn’t increase your probability simply because you previously lost.
It only increases the amount exposed to the next random outcome.
